Fees and Cost Over Time
HWSM charges 0.55% per year while VTI charges 0.03%. On a $10,000 position that is $55 vs $3 annually, a gap of $52 per year that compounds over a long holding period. On income, HWSM currently yields 1.14% against 1.03% for VTI.
Holdings Overlap
92.0% of HWSM's money is in holdings VTI also owns. 2.4% of VTI's money is in holdings HWSM also owns.
Most of HWSM is already inside VTI. Owning both mostly buys the same companies twice.
155 positions in common, counted across the 165 positions we hold weights for in HWSM and 3,463 in VTI, against full books of 166 and 3,543.
What only one of them owns
Our book lists 1,032 positions for VTI that do not appear in our book for HWSM (95.1% of the fund), and 6 for HWSM that do not appear in VTI (5.4%).
Some of those will be the same company recorded under a different code in one of the two books, so the real difference in what you would own is no larger than this and may be smaller. We do not name the individual positions here for that reason.
